> Hi Folks, > > I'm sort of confused, and maybe someones seen this. > If I run a cacheing dns server somewhere on my private > internal lan (10.x.x.x), then, by definition, it's not > authoriative for my zone and just cache's query responses > it gets back, correct? Right.
> If you guys run a cacheing dns server, how do you > configure it to be able to reply for the masq'd internal > LAN? Charles gave instructions on how to configure dnscache to reply to reqeusts from your internal LAN, but if you want a name server that is authoritative for your zone, you can use tinydns.
